The Vancouver Giants are excited to announce their schedule for 2024 Training Camp, presented by Chevrolet, which will take place for the first time at the Langley Events Centre.

Training Camp begins with registration on Wednesday, Aug. 28 and concludes with the annual Quinn vs. Howe Legends Cup game on Saturday, Aug. 31 at 6 p.m.

Rosters will be announced soon, but will include returning players, prospects and free agent invites. They will be grouped into three teams for Friday's intrasquad games: Team Byram, Team Gallagher and Team Lucic.

This will be the first Training Camp for 2024 WHL Draft selections, including first-round pick Blake Chorney and third-round pick Landon Horiachka, who each signed with the club earlier this summer.

On-ice action gets started on Thursday, Aug. 29. The first intrasquad game will take place on Friday, Aug. 30 at 2:15 p.m.

All ice sessions and the Quinn/Howe game are open to the public for free.

Following camp, the Giants will play four preseason games, with three being hosted in the Greater Vancouver Area, beginning with back-to-back games at Jon Baillie Arena in Port Coquitlam on Sept. 7 and 8 versus the Victoria Royals.

The G-Men will also play the Kelowna Rockets on the road on Saturday, Sept. 14 at 6:05 p.m. and host the Rockets on Sunday, Sept. 15 at 4 p.m. at Ladner Leisure Centre.
